‘Bodyguard’ by Iranian director Ebrahim Hatamikia wins top prizes at VIFF 2017

PayvandNews – ‘Bodyguard’ directed by Iranian filmmaker Ebrahim Hatamikia won Best Art Direction, Best Supporting Actor (for Babak Hamidian), and Best Director award at the 3rd Vienna Independent Film Festival (VIFF 2017) in Austria. ‘Forgiveness’ by Iran’s Rima Irani also won Best Short Film Award at the festival. Iran launches Freedom of Information website

PayvandNews – Iran has launched a website that allows its citizens to freely seek and obtain information from all government organizations and institutions according to law. The website was officially launched during a ceremony attended by Iranian Minister of Culture Seyyed Reza Salehi Amiri and Minister for Communications and Information Technology Mahmoud Va’ezi on Saturday. Iran Plans First Oil-And-Gas Tenders After Sanctions Easing

RFL/RE – The Iranian government is planning to announce tenders for the exploration of 14 oil-and-gas blocks over the next three months, a top executive at Iran’s NIOC state oil company has said.
